Cory is one of the UK’s leading resource management, recycling, and energy recovery companies. We use the River Thames as a green highway, saving around 100,000 truck movements a year – a vital way of getting traffic off the road and making London safer and less polluted. As a river-based business, we are proud to support the growth of the Thames economy and the wider inland waterways sector.

Role Overview

As a Plater/Welder at Cory, you’ll play a hands-on role in maintaining and repairing the vessels that keep London’s waste moving by river. Working as part of our Ship Repair Services team, you’ll support both in-house operations and third-party customers, helping ensure our fleet of tugs, barges, and containers remains safe, compliant, and reliable.

Key Responsibilities

  • Maintain and repair vessels, including fabricating steel barge and vessel sections.
  • Carry out emergency repairs and salvage work.
  • Support yard activities, vessel movements in and out of slipways.
  • Ensure general upkeep of our Gravesend site.
  • Occasionally work at other sites, typically our Charlton location.
  • Work in full compliance with international, national, and company legislation.
  • Take part in emergency exercises.
  • Support the development of others, including assisting in the training of apprentices.
